HierarchicalDataSourceControl::GetHierarchicalView Method
Gets the view helper object for the IHierarchicalDataSource interface for the specified path.
Assembly: System.Web (in System.Web.dll)
protected: virtual HierarchicalDataSourceView^ GetHierarchicalView( String^ viewPath ) abstract
Parameters
- viewPath
- Type: System::String
The hierarchical path of the view to retrieve.
Return Value
Type: System.Web.UI::HierarchicalDataSourceViewA HierarchicalDataSourceView that represents a single view of the data at the hierarchical level identified by the viewPath parameter.
This GetHierarchicalView method provides the default implementation for the HierarchicalDataSourceControl class, which simply returns nullptr. Classes that derive from the HierarchicalDataSourceControl class override this method and provide an implementation to return a strongly typed view that derives from HierarchicalDataSourceView.
